PAGS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

193 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PagSeguro Digital (PAGS)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$1.48B — down 33% from $2.22B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new PAGS positions and 33 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 73 added to existing stakes and 63 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Norges Bank, adding an estimated $54M. The largest seller was Marshall Wace, cutting an estimated $44.2M.
